Gary Campbell (linebacker)
Gary Kalani Campbell (born March 4, 1952) is a former American football linebacker who played seven seasons in the National Football League (NFL) for the Chicago Bears from 1977 to 1983.[1] He was selected by the Pittsburgh Steelers in the tenth round of the 1976 NFL draft.[2]
